Cagliari have made the signing of 21-year-old Milan striker Lorenzo Colombo their priority before the end of the summer transfer window according to recent reports from transfer expert Gianluca Di Marzio. 

The highly-rated youngster has spent the last two-and-a-half seasons on loan deals away from San Siro, joining Cremonese in Serie B in 2020-21, SPAL for 2021-22 and Lecce in Serie A for the most recent campaign. 

While with Lecce, Colombo registered five goals from 33 league appearances during his first full season playing regularly in the top flight. 

Di Marzio suggests that Cagliari also have other options to bring in up front, namely Bruno Petkovic from Dinamo Zagreb, or Jean-Pierre Nsame of Young Boys, who turned out for Venezia on loan in 2022, although both players are considered to be ‘second choices’. 

Cagliari will get their Serie A campaign underway on Monday, August 21 with an away trip to face Ivan Juric’s Torino at the Stadio Olimpico Grande Torino.
